The music world is evolving, and the Recording Academy is adapting along with it.
For the 69th Grammy Awards in 2027, the Academy has announced several exciting updates, most notably the introduction of the Best Asian Pop Music Performance category.
This new award aims to celebrate the incredible artistic excellence of Asian pop music, specifically recognizing genres like K-pop, J-pop, and C-pop.
While many view this as a landmark moment for global representation, it has also sparked conversations among fans about whether specialized categories help integrate or inadvertently separate artists from mainstream recognition.
Beyond this, the 2027 Grammys will feature four other new categories and expanded eligibility for the Best New Artist award, acknowledging that modern music careers often take more time to flourish.
